Skip site navigation (1)Skip section navigation (2)
Date:      Thu, 7 Aug 2003 00:43:29 -0700
From:      Kris Kennaway <kris@obsecurity.org>
To:        David O'Brien <obrien@freebsd.org>
Cc:        Kris Kennaway <kris@obsecurity.org>
Subject:   Re: ponderous 'make world' times post GCC 3.3...
Message-ID:  <20030807074329.GA73001@rot13.obsecurity.org>
In-Reply-To: <20030807064426.GA69176@dragon.nuxi.com>
References:  <20030807062536.GA68747@dragon.nuxi.com> <20030807063210.GA72779@rot13.obsecurity.org> <20030807064426.GA69176@dragon.nuxi.com>

next in thread | previous in thread | raw e-mail | index | archive | help

--Q68bSM7Ycu6FN28Q
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Wed, Aug 06, 2003 at 11:44:26PM -0700, David O'Brien wrote:
> On Wed, Aug 06, 2003 at 11:32:10PM -0700, Kris Kennaway wrote:
> > On Wed, Aug 06, 2003 at 11:25:36PM -0700, David O'Brien wrote:
> > > Am I the only one that saw 'make world' go from almost 3 hours with G=
CC
> > > 3.2 to:
> >=20
> > Nope, that's just gcc 3.3.  Someone had a reference to some benchmarks
> > the gcc people did that showed progressive slowdowns over the course
> > of the gcc 3.x branch.
>=20
> It has been argued by Richard Henderson (urber GCC hacker) that 3.3 is no
> slower than 3.2.  I'm now thinking that this is a cache-size issue.  I
> wonder if GCC is blowing out my tiny 256KB cache.

I havent benchmarked make world myself recently, but the benchmark I
remember was compiling some reference version of gcc with different
gcc compiler versions (from 2.7.x to 3.4.x), and it demonstrated
something like a factor of 3 slowdown from gcc 3.2 to 3.3 on i386.
I'm paraphrasing from memory though, so I could be way off.

Kris

--Q68bSM7Ycu6FN28Q
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.2 (FreeBSD)

iD8DBQE/MgMhWry0BWjoQKURAm9nAJ9SnlA34joaQ5kbKBdZbifINxyG2wCeNnh1
sIYyYYGWcM7NrNKAuetTnOU=
=UMi+
-----END PGP SIGNATURE-----

--Q68bSM7Ycu6FN28Q--



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20030807074329.GA73001>